Description Date of election speculative.

No new election was held in 1810, as Louisiana was in the process of becoming a new state. Congress did allow Allen B. Magruder and Elegius Fromentin to serve as "agents" on the floor of the U.S. House in the absence of an official delegate.

There was thus a vacancy in the office from 3/4/1811 to 4/30/1812 when the position of Delegate ended.
